First Troubleshoot Basic Network and Account Issues
When facing login failures, don't rush to use complex methods; starting with basic troubleshooting is more efficient. First, check if your phone or computer has a stable network connection. Try opening other Chinese websites like Baidu to confirm your network can access Chinese resources normally.
Next, verify your QQ account status, such as whether it's frozen due to long-term inactivity or if you entered the wrong password. You can ask a friend in China to log in to your account to confirm there's no issue with the account itself. If it's a password error, reset it directly via your bound phone number or email.
Tip: If your friend in China can log in normally, the problem is most likely with the network environment in Morocco.

Check Device Time and System Settings
Many people overlook the impact of device time. The security verification system of the Chinese version of QQ has strict requirements for time synchronization. If the local time in Morocco deviates significantly from Beijing time, the system will judge it as an abnormal environment and reject the login request.
You can manually adjust your device time to Beijing time or enable the automatic network time synchronization function. In addition, check your device's system permissions to ensure QQ has obtained necessary permissions such as network access and storage, avoiding login failures due to insufficient permissions.
Try QQ International Version or Web Version as a Transition
If you can't find a suitable network tool temporarily, you can use QQ International or the web version as a transition. QQ International has no strict regional restrictions and can be logged in directly in Morocco. Although it has fewer features than the Chinese version, basic functions like chatting and file transfer work normally.
The web version of QQ can be logged in through domestic online web platforms, which is simpler to operate and doesn't require additional software downloads. You can switch back to the Chinese version later when the network environment issue is resolved.
